Tips for Keeping Your New Windshield Crystal Clear! When you get a new windshield, it’s essential to adopt practices that will help maintain its clarity. Here are some handy tips: Regular Cleaning Routine: Just like any other part of your car, your windshield requires regular cleaning. Use a soft microfiber cloth along with a high-quality glass cleaner to wipe away dust, dirt, and grime. Use the Right Cleaning Products: Avoid using ammonia-based cleaners as they can damage the tint on the glass and harm the rubber seals around it. Opt for products specifically designed for auto glass. Inspect Wiper Blades: Your wipers play a significant role in maintaining visibility during rain or snow. Regularly check them for wear and replace them if necessary to prevent scratching the glass. Avoid Parking Under Trees: If possible, park your vehicle away from trees to avoid sap, bird droppings, and leaves that can create messes on your windshield. Stay Away from Extreme Temperatures: Rapid changes in temperature can lead to cracks or chips in your windshield. Try to avoid parking in direct sunlight or freezing temperatures if possible. Use a Windshield Cover: During winter months, consider using a windshield cover to protect against frost and ice buildup. Keep Your Car Interior Clean: Dust and debris inside your vehicle can easily find its way onto the windshield when you open windows or doors. Be Cautious with Car Washes: Opt for touchless car washes if you're concerned about scratches from brushes or sponges. Understand Rain Repellent Products: Consider applying a rain repellent product designed specifically for windshields; these products help water bead up and roll off easily instead of collecting on the surface. Understanding Auto Glass Types Before diving deeper into maintenance tips, it's beneficial to understand what types of auto glass are commonly used in vehicles today. Laminated vs Tempered Glass Laminated Glass: Often used for windshields, laminated glass consists of two layers of glass with a polyvinyl butyral (PVB) interlayer. It offers better sound insulation and resistance against shattering. Tempered Glass: Typically found in side windows and rear windows, tempered glass is heated during manufacturing processes making it stronger than regular glass but more prone to shattering into small pieces when broken. Comprehensive Coverage Most comprehensive coverage plans include auto glass repairs or replacements without affecting premiums. 2. Deductibles Check whether there's a deductible associated with glass claims; some companies offer zero-deductible options specifically for windshields.
